History:
The surname Munuswamy, deeply rooted in South Indian culture, likely started as a personal name. "Munu" might be short for names like "Muniyappa," a regional deity, and its combined with "Swami," meaning "lord" or "master." This surname probably became hereditary over generations.

Description:
The surname Munuswamy is common in South India, especially among Tamil and Telugu speakers. The religion associated with MUNUSWAMY surname is hinduism. The communities associated with this surname are brahmin, naidu and vanniyar. The MotherTounge associated with this surname is tamil.
Its often linked to different sub-castes within the Hindu social system. These communities might include parts of the Mudaliar community in Tamil Nadu or similar farming groups in Andhra Pradesh and Telangana. The name itself probably comes from a personal name and a respectful ending, showing a religious connection to a god, which was a typical naming custom.
The surname Munuswamy, which is common in India, is mainly used by people who speak Tamil and Telugu. These are the two main languages spoken by people with this surname. Tamil, a Dravidian language with a rich literary history, is mostly spoken in Tamil Nadu and parts of Sri Lanka. Telugu, another Dravidian language, is mainly spoken in Andhra Pradesh and Telangana. Although people with this surname might also know other languages like English or Hindi because of their education or where they live, Tamil and Telugu are their main linguistic heritage.
The surname Muniswamy also appears as Munuswami and Munusamy.
